About Perplexity AI

Perplexity AI operates an AI-powered answer engine that synthesizes cited answers from web sources, and has expanded into an agentic AI browser called Comet, alongside enterprise search and finance products. Founded in 2022 by CEO Aravind Srinivas, the company is headquartered in San Francisco and has grown its headcount roughly 4x since 2023, reaching an estimated ~1,400 employees by mid-2026.

Perplexity's financing history has been steep: from a $3.1M seed round in September 2022, the company progressed through Series A ($25.6M, $156.7M post-money) in April 2023, Series B ($73.6M, $520M) in January 2024, Series C ($250M, $2.8B) in April 2024, a Growth Equity round ($250M, $3.0B) in June 2024, Series D ($500M, $9.0B) in December 2024, and Series E ($500M, $14.0B) in May 2025, before two Series E Extension rounds in July 2025 ($100M, $18.0B) and September 2025 ($200M, $20.0B). Total capital raised across these rounds stands at roughly $1.9 billion, with 42% of that total raised in just the latest three rounds.

The company's backers include Nvidia, SoftBank Group (via both direct investment and SoftBank Vision Fund 2), Jeff Bezos (Bezos Expeditions), New Enterprise Associates, Institutional Venture Partners, Bessemer Venture Partners, Accel, and Databricks Ventures, among others.

Perplexity has also made headline-grabbing strategic moves, including an unsolicited $34.5 billion bid for Google Chrome and a proposed merger with TikTok's US operations – neither of which has closed as of this writing, adding a layer of event-risk and capital-allocation uncertainty on top of an already fast-rising valuation.

Main Solutions / Products

  • Perplexity: AI-powered answer engine providing direct, cited answers synthesized from web sources.
  • Comet: AI-native agentic web browser (launched July 2025) providing in-browser research and task assistance.
  • Perplexity Pro: Subscription tier with expanded model access and features.
  • Perplexity Enterprise: Enterprise-focused search and knowledge product.
  • Perplexity Finance: Finance-focused data and analysis product.

Valuation & Secondary Market Snapshot

  • Last primary round price: $695.44 per share (Series E Extension, Sep 2025)
  • Indicative secondary market price: $60.07 (Aug 2026)
  • Market-implied valuation: $17.3B, a roughly 91% discount to the last primary round's implied per-share value
  • Secondary trading volume: $190.8M across disclosed periods, peaking at $85.6M in Q4 2025 before cooling into 2026

As with any private-company pricing, secondary data should be read as directional rather than definitive: primary round prices, secondary bids/offers, and SPV structures can differ meaningfully, and sparse trading means quarter-to-quarter moves can overstate or understate true fair value.

Risks

  • Intensifying competition from OpenAI, Google (Gemini/AI Overviews), and Anthropic in AI search and answer products.
  • High-profile bids (Chrome, TikTok) remain unsolicited/proposed and could distract management or simply fail to close.
  • Continued reliance on large primary fundraising rounds to sustain valuation amid still-developing monetization.
  • Publisher and content-licensing/copyright disputes remain an overhang for AI answer engines generally.

Catalysts

  • Developments in the Google Chrome divestiture process tied to the DOJ antitrust case.
  • Continued Comet browser adoption and monetization.
  • Additional funding rounds at higher valuations.
